    Default Do you think Doyle's Room will go to Cake?

    Here's a question for you guys that I have been pondering all day. Most of you know the situation with Microgaming, but I heard rumors that Doyle's may go to the Cake network. Obviously this is great for Doyle's room, but will that kill all the other up and coming rooms on Cake like Cardspike and Redstar?

    Personally, Doyle's left a bad taste in my mouth after leaving, then coming back and our players were gone. Nonetheless I think it would be a strong brand on Cake. I just wonder what that would do to the existing market. Thoughts?

    I think they would go sweet with the Cake network. Red Star doesn't allow US Players and is mostly russian players, so Doyles Room won't conflict with them. I don't think anyone would drop promoting Cake itself. So it really only leaves CardSpike as a big competitor. With all the problems CardSpike has been having I could see it having serious issues if Doyle's Room came over.

    I really hope they don't go to Merge. I hate the network so far. My conversions are so bad and players value really low there. I've only been around for like 9 months, but I'm totally not impressed so far.

    I dont think it would make any significant difference to the Merge group until Merge starts changing their program. Right now the site caters to low limit players, and as I was mentioning to someone else the other day they need to chop those freerolls and starting investing that cash into grabbing some attention from serious players. They need to fix the problems within before bringing more people on board. No matter how many skins they add its not going to make that big of a difference...for the most part I think the already existing player base just swaps around between the different rooms. I would like to see a big name there, at this point I just dont think it would do anything.

    For Cake my thought are like Jeremy. If Doyles goes to Cake it will kill the other rooms, not only from an affiliate perspective but from players to.

    Would you rather hear a name that most people don't associate with anything ie the name of the room before you signup or would you rather here endorsed by Doyle Brunson. Players know who he is and I think by having his face on the label it would add that much more credibility in an area where the other rooms can't compete. Because of that reason, if they did move, as an affiliate I would be that much more inclined to push Doyle's on the Cake network than anyone else, including Cake.
